Output 6c7bc1e98bc72bfa64f5c0d9ab147eb3c702821a77c387e586ae0d3cc5929240:42

value
3808461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851750d3d3f22de255ceb712f6e2b6e8cb9f33c1 OP_EQUAL
address
3Dpjj4b6WjuoJoue4W4vzdU4p3dCt9CygR
transaction
6c7bc1e98bc72bfa64f5c0d9ab147eb3c702821a77c387e586ae0d3cc5929240
spent
true